I'd suggest what STV have done is just been incredibly lazy and taken the Record story at face value without doing any background research.

In the same way a load of papers (and the BBC) were caught out a while back writing the obituary of a dead composer when they claimed he had also written songs for S Club 7 because someone had edited his Wikipedia. :lol:

Newspapers have to publish a heap of content everyday, both in print and online with ever-shrinking staff and budgets. Do people really find it that hard to believe that they take shortcuts?

I'm not defending the Record or STV here, it's poor from both of them. I'm just pointing out that this is how print journalism operates across Britain, rather than being part of a specific anti-independence agenda.
